The size of your fridge should associate with both your kitchen area space and your family's needs. The typical fridge procedures between 30 to 36 inches in width and can vary from 60 to 70 inches in height. However, it's important to account for additional space for ventilation and door clearance.

For capability, refrigerators are generally determined in cubic feet. A household of four generally requires 18 to 22 cubic feet of space, while bigger families may need 25 cubic feet or more. Utilize this table as a standard for capacity:
Family SizeAdvised Capacity (Cubic Feet)1-2 individuals10-143-4 individuals18-225+ individuals25+Energy Efficiency
Energy effectiveness is an important consideration when selecting a fridge. Energy-efficient designs not only decrease your carbon footprint however also conserve you money on your monthly utility bills. Look for the Energy Star label, which signifies that the home appliance satisfies strict energy effectiveness guidelines set by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ency.
Design and style
Fridges can be found in different styles, such as top-freezer, bottom-freezer, side-by-side, and French door models. Consider your cooking area design and individual preference when selecting a style. Here's a quick summary of each type:
StyleDescriptionProsConsTop-FreezerTraditional design with the fresh food section on top.Usually more affordableLess convenient for access to fresh products.Bottom-FreezerFresh food section at eye level, freezer listed below.More hassle-free to gain access toMay use up more flooring area.Side-by-SideFreezer and refrigerator compartments beside each other.Easy access to both areas in a narrow style.Limited drawer space; requires bending to gain access to lower items.French DoorFunctions double doors for the fridge and a pull-out freezer.Elegant design, ample storage space, and benefit.Generally more expensive.Features

Cooling Technology
Fridge designs use either traditional compressors or contemporary inverter technology. Inverter models run at differing speeds, which can be more energy-efficient and keep constant temperature levels. Traditional compressors switch on and off as needed, which may provide less performance and temperature level control.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
What is the typical life-span of a refrigerator?
Most refrigerators last in between 10 to 20 years, depending upon the brand, design, and upkeep.
How frequently should I clean my fridge?
It's a good idea to clean your refrigerator every 3-6 months, that includes wiping down surface areas, checking expiration dates, and cleaning the coils.
Can I put my refrigerator outside?
While some refrigerators are created for outdoor usage, most are not. Severe temperature levels can affect efficiency, so it's finest to keep them indoors.
What should I do if my refrigerator is not cooling?
Initially, examine the thermostat settings. If it's set correctly and still not cooling, check the coils for dust buildup. If the problem continues, consider calling a repair professional.
